Since 2016, there has been a change in how ASQA treats non-compliances. Previosuly, where non-compliance was identified, providers were only required to provide evidence to ASQA that they had updated their procedures or training and assessment strategies.

ASQA Appeals

Providers must lodge an appeal to ASQA to review a decision within 30 days after they are informed of ASQA's decision.

AAT Appeals

AAT appeal must be lodged within 28 days of receiving notification of the ASQA decision.

Section 26 Notices

Section 26 of the National Vocational Education and Training Regulator Act 2011 requires that an NVR registered training organisation must give the National VET Regulator such information as the Regulator requests.
